PORT Adelaide has confirmed its interest in Geelong ruckman-forward Nathan Vardy, but his move to Alberton hinges on finding a trade for ruckman Matthew Lobbe.
And the Cats are dismissing the Power — or any AFL rival — has made a move on contracted speedster Steven Motlop.
